UCLA Prof Quanquan Gu Clarifies: AI-Assisted Verifiable Proofs Are Progress for Humanity

QuanquanGu · x · 2026-09-13

UCLA professor Quanquan Gu clarified his stance amid the controversy over AI-assisted mathematical proofs: he deeply respects mathematicians and math, and concerns around data use, attribution, and research norms are valid and should be carefully addressed. His core point stands, however: if AI helps produce a rigorous, independently verifiable proof, that is progress for humanity. The statement attempts to draw a line between respecting academic norms and embracing AI-accelerated research.
